Definitions:

Attached Résumé

A curriculum vitae or professional profile sent along with a job application, typically as a document file.

Open Job Market

The portion of the job market that is publicly advertised and available to any qualified job seeker.

Systems Analyst

A professional who analyzes and designs business systems, managing requirements and ensuring the IT solutions align with business needs.

Troubleshooting Skills

The ability to diagnose and resolve problems, typically involving technology or machinery.
